What are the advantages of the design of Aikop ultrapure water systems?

1. The design of the circulation loop

A professional serpentine distribution system is adopted to completely avoid any dead water end or corner, and to control the chemical quality and bacterial content that actually affect the point of use. For long delivery circuits that cause high pressure drop, fixed-point pressurization is adopted on the pipeline to ensure the flow rate and pressure at each point of use.

2. Flow rate design of serpentine circulation loop

Improper flow rate will lead to the growth of biofilm in the transmission and distribution circuit. When selecting the correct pipeline according to the flow rate, the maximum water discharge rate at the point of use must be considered. Generally, the flow rate of the transmission circuit is the maximum instantaneous water discharge rate at the point of use multiplied by 1.3~1.5 is calculated.

Studies have confirmed that no biofilm will grow if the flow rate is greater than 0.7m/s. The flow rate of the main pipe is 3.0m/s, and it is generally recommended to maintain it at 1.5m/s to reduce the formation of biofilm on the inner wall of the delivery pipeline.

3. Material selection of transmission and distribution system

The material selection of the transmission and distribution system is an important consideration. The material of the system first needs to have stable chemical and physical properties, and no leachables will be released, polluting pure water and ultra-pure water. Ultrapure water is highly corrosive, and the material of the transmission and distribution system needs to have excellent corrosion resistance and corrosion resistance.

4. Selection of point-of-use water valve and its accessories

When selecting a point-of-use valve and its accessories, careful consideration needs to be given to whether it will back-contaminate the distribution circuit. It is better to use a diaphragm valve at the point of use, and pay attention to the cleaning of the diaphragm valve.

5. Selection of pipe material

Taiwan, CHINA-made UPVC has been successfully used for many years in liquid conveying and discharge systems. The stable physical and chemical properties of UPVC are very suitable for transporting pure water or ultrapure water, and can also meet the harsh operating environment.

UPVC pipe fittings are different from metal pipe fittings. They are light in weight, smooth inside, no rust, no fouling, good corrosion resistance and chemical resistance, easy construction, adopt cold glue fusion method, the joints are not easy to leak, and the pipe wall is thick. The method of burying pipes in the wall can avoid ultraviolet radiation, so that the service life of UPVCSCH.80 pipe fittings can be as long as more than 30 years.
